The area of the parallelogram is 24 square miles find its base and height?

Mathematics
1 answer:
denis-greek [22]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Base-3 mi

Height-8 mi

Step-by-step explanation:

The area of a parallelogram is base*height.

Base*height=24

Now we just need to number that multiply to get 24. Those numbers can be 3 and 8 because 3*8=24.
